# Approvals — Restocker Planner Plugins

All third-party plugins for the Cartwell Restock Planner require approval before listing. Submit a manifest, changelog, and test evidence against the staging machine fleet in Norbeck. Plugins touching inventory mutation or pricing need a second review. Turnaround is five business days. Resubmissions after rejection restart the clock. Do not publish pre-approval builds to the shared registry. Final sign-off authority for all plugin approvals rests with the person listed below.

account owner for bawip-tahag: Raleth Quenok

Blue-green deploy, Ledgerfin billing worker: spin up the green pool, drain blue once invoice queues hit zero, then flip the router. Plugin authors: your hooks must be idempotent, since both pools may briefly run. Green artifacts won't boot unless signed, so grab the current deploy key below.

release key, hadug-kawef: bky13_mPGeFZeR1GZ1G

# ProctorQueue Data Stores

The Vigilora exam-proctoring queue persists session claims in a single relational store; the in-memory broker is only a cache and can be flushed safely. All durable state — proctor assignments, escalation flags, and audit stamps — lives in the claims database. Treat it as the sole source of truth. The queue workers connect using the following string.

primary connection of yagep-kahip = redis://giliel_svc:zYiKsLL2PLpfPL@db-348f.xolmarsys.corp:5432/fenwyn

## Onboarding — Markdown Pipeline (Inkmere)

Inkmere docs render through a three-stage pipeline: parse, sanitize, emit. Releases rebuild all templates; never hot-patch emitted HTML. Broken renders usually mean a sanitizer rule change — check the rules diff first. The render cluster only accepts builds from the release channel, and every build artifact must be signed before upload. Sign artifacts with the deploy key below.

release key, hafop-tajef: bky13_s2vaFVNJTHfBL

Heads up, assistants — the summer intern cohort for Project Tindral lands Monday morning at the Fennwick Court office. Expect eight interns; their desks are set up on level three near the kitchen. Badges won't be printed until Tuesday, so they'll need temporary access for day one. When they arrive, greet them at reception and give them the door code below.

staff pass of tahog-kaweg = bdg-Q-26